Why Glycerin and Xanthan Gum Matter

Glycerin serves dual functions: it acts as a humectant to retain moisture in the stratum corneum and reduces friction during wiping—critical for fragile newborn skin, which is 30% thinner than adult skin and has an immature barrier function. The concentration used (0.4%) falls within the 0.2–0.6% range validated in a randomized controlled trial (n=214) showing statistically significant reduction in transepidermal water loss (TEWL) after 14 days versus control wipes (p<0.001). Xanthan gum provides viscosity without occlusion; unlike petrolatum-based thickeners, it does not impair natural desquamation or trap microbes in the diaper area.

When to Pause or Switch Wipes

Monitor for subtle signs—not just redness. Early indicators of intolerance include persistent ‘dew-drop’ appearance on skin surface (indicating disrupted ceramide layer), increased flaking at thigh creases, or a faint vinegar-like odor (suggestive of Candida overgrowth triggered by pH shift). If any appear within 72 hours of initiating Silka, discontinue and consult your pediatrician.
